MiMedia Holdings Inc. (MIM.V) faced a significant downturn today, dropping 5.56% and closing at CA$0.17.
In the latest trading session, MiMedia Holdings Inc. saw its stock price fall sharply, reflecting a challenging environment for the company. As investors react to the market dynamics, the implications of this decline are worth examining.

Methodology: Range is calculated using 30-day realized volatility via geometric Brownian motion (log-normal model). 68% band = ±1σ, 95% band = ±2σ. This is a statistical model, not a prediction. Past volatility does not guarantee future results. Not financial advice.

Market Reaction
The 5.56% drop in MiMedia's stock price today is a stark reminder of the volatility that can accompany small-cap stocks. Investors are often quick to react to market signals, and today's decline may reflect broader concerns about the company's growth trajectory.
Future Outlook
Despite the recent downturn, MiMedia has secured funding through a private placement and formed strategic partnerships. However, the lack of immediate positive news may leave investors cautious. For those interested in the tech sector, monitoring MiMedia's next moves will be crucial as it navigates these challenges.
